Beginnings in the Pacific NW

In the early 80’s, a satellite campus of the New Testament Christian Seminary-St. Louis was established in Washington state. For several years students attended classes in Missouri and Washington; in 1990 the Seminary officially moved to the new Graham campus. For many years, because of our limited facilities, chapel services were for Seminary students only.

In 1990 God gave us our first real church building on the new Campus and since then we have enjoyed community outreach.

In January of 1999 we moved to our current chapel.
